Take the logical approach.
You already know that your grid is AN55.
You just need to find the centre of 17 if you want to be more precise.
You could just take the centre from AN55.
Using your compass draw out the required distance.
What you do not know is how close you are to reaching that perimeter until you draw it out.
The radio message will give you the patrol start time.
This can also be seen in the Captains Log if you miss the radio message or do not receive one.
Further help can be obtained in TDW's Option File Editor Viewer and enabling the Player Objectives Tab.


The yellow icon showing below the camera bar is controlled by the player objective icon that can be found by opening the extended top bar.

A green confirmation pops up to tell you that you have completed the time for the grid ( not shown) and shows a new patrol grid (showing).
When all 3 patrol grids are completed the yellow icon disappears automatically.
